> I was running Wireshark within valgrind and spotted one issue when using the
> Expert Info Composite window.
> 
> Both of the Expert Info dialogs define and use a typedef called
> expert_tapdata_t.  One version of the typedef is defined in the expert_dlg.c
> file, while the other is defined in expert_comp_table.h.
> 
> The typedef defined in expert_dlg.c includes 12 fields whereas the one defined
> in expert_comp_table.h has 11 fields.  Within expert_dlg.c's typedef the 3rd
> field is a 'GtkCList *table'.  The 'GtkCList *table' field is not present in
> expert_comp_table.h's typedef.
> 
> Assuming that GtkClist pointers are 4 bytes in length, any etd variables
> allocated within expert_comp_init() at expert_comp_dlg.c:187, will be four
> bytes smaller (44 bytes) then etd variables allocated within expert_dlg_init()
> at expert_dlg:493 (48 bytes).
> 
> Both expert info dialogs share some common tap functions, which reference
> fields defined inside the etd variables.  valgrind alerted to the fact that
> expert_dlg's expert_dlg_draw() was attempting to access the variable
> "etd->severity_report_level" which was beyond the end of the allocated block of
> data.  This particular etd structure was allocated from within
> expert_comp_init().
